1 Samuel 20:16-21 New Living Translation (NLT)

16. So Jonathan made a solemn pact with David, saying, “May the lord destroy all your enemies!”

17. And Jonathan made David reaffirm his vow of friendship again, for Jonathan loved David as he loved himself.

18. Then Jonathan said, “Tomorrow we celebrate the new moon festival. You will be missed when your place at the table is empty.

19. The day after tomorrow, toward evening, go to the place where you hid before, and wait there by the stone pile.

20. I will come out and shoot three arrows to the side of the stone pile as though I were shooting at a target.

21. Then I will send a boy to bring the arrows back. If you hear me tell him, ‘They’re on this side,’ then you will know, as surely as the lord lives, that all is well, and there is no trouble.
